Organism | Comment | Expression |
---|---|---|
Rattus norvegicus | Pdk4 gene expression is inhibited by insulin. Knockdown of C/EBPbeta reduces Pdk4 gene expression and decreases the T3 induction of PDK4 in primary hepatocytes | down |
Rattus norvegicus | C/EBPbeta induces Pdk4 gene expression and increases PDK4 promoter activity, and decreases pyruvate dehydrogenase complex activity. Binding of C/EBPbeta via its sequence elements localized between -634 to -626 and -96 to -87. Pdk4 is also induced by thyroid hormone T3, glucocorticoids, retinoic acid, and long chain fatty acids. The peroxisome proliferator-activated receptor gamma coactivator PGC-1alpha enhances the T3 induction of the Pdk4 expression | up |
General Information | Comment | Organism |
---|---|---|
physiological function | regulation of Pdk4 gene expression by the CCAAT/enhancer-binding protein beta, i.e. C/EBPbeta, which modulates the expression of multiple hepatic genes including those involved in metabolism, development, and inflammation. C/EBPbeta induces Pdk4 gene expression and decreases pyruvate dehydrogenase complex activity, and it participates in the T3 induction of the Cpt1a and Pdk4 genes, overview | Rattus norvegicus |
